Ingredients needed for Creamy Mushrooms

  • Butter – approx. 25 grams
  • Mushrooms – 1 Cup of sliced button, Swiss or portobello mushrooms
  • Salt – 1/4 teaspoon
  • Pepper – to taste
  • Cream – 1/4 Cup
  • Corn flour – 1/4 – 1/2 teaspoon (may not be required)

Tools you may need to make Creamy Mushrooms

Medium size frying pan/skillet, cutting board, sharp knife, wooden spoon

How to make Creamy Mushrooms

Step One

In a medium fry pan/skillet melt the butter over a medium heat, add the sliced mushroom to the melted butter and gently cook. Stir occasionally to avoid sticking.

Step Two

As the liquid from the mushrooms slowly gathers in the pan season with salt and pepper. Add a little more butter if required to avoid sticking.

Step Three

Continue to gently cook until the mushrooms are tender, this should take approximately 5-7 minutes. There should be moisture from the mushrooms in the bottom of the pan, do not allow it to dry out.

Step Four

Once the mushrooms are tender add the cream. Simmer gently for a few minutes until the sauce thickens.

Step Five

If you accidently add too much cream, thicken the sauce by adding small amounts of corn flour to the liquid until desired texture is achieved. Just make sure you give the corn-flour time to cook for a few minutes – it will thicken quite quickly.

Serve on your choice of toast or crusty bread for a delicious lunch.

TRY: adding creamy mushrooms to your steak or pasta as an amazing dinner option.
